I just received my new Sota Nova VI last week.  I have listened to about 20 albums now and absolutely love it.  I started with the Sapphire Series III in 1992, upgraded to a used Star in 2018 and now have upgraded to the Nova VI with vacuum, the magnetic bearing with the Eclipse Condor motor package and the Roadrunner Tachometer.  I used my Sapphire for 26 years.  The Star with vacuum improved on the bass and I also appreciated the vacuum which took record warps out of the picture.  But this new Nova VI is a big leap forward I find.  The platter is dead quiet, more clarity in the mid bass and bass and cymbals sound amazing.  Speed drift is a thing of the past with the Roadrunner tachometer that feedbacks speed to the condor.  I can put my finger against the side of the platter with slight pressure and the speed does not change.

All three Sota's offer a great presentation.  I can only imagine what the Cosmos can do.  I'm very pleased with the sound of this new table and am glad I was patient enough to wait for it.  I ordered my new Nova VI last August.  Donna told me then that delivery would be in March.  She kept that promise date with just a few days to spare but Sota delivered.
